Antony Ugoni

Chair at IAPA

Antony began his career as a Biostatistician to the Alfred Group of Hospitals jointly with Monash Medical School. He then moved to a lecturing role in Biostatistics at the University of Melbourne. Antony has co-authored more than 50 peer reviewed articles in medical research and still actively contributes to this industry today.

From 2000 to 2013 Antony worked at National Australia Bank leading many ground breaking teams and projects. Antony started as the lead for NAB’s Credit Card Fraud Analytics Group (the first of its kind in Australia) which used data driven insights to reduce fraud losses by more than 50%. Antony was then offered the opportunity to lead the Customer Analytics team and during his tenure he identified more than $100b worth of revenue opportunities.

Antony holds an MSc from LaTrobe University, is an Associate Lecturer at the School of Physiotherapy, University of Melbourne and a member of the Advisory Board for the Centre of Business Analytics, University of Melbourne.
